Karen Halttunen is a scholar working on Literature and Literary Theory, Cultural Studies and Marketing. According to data from OpenAlex, Karen Halttunen has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 715 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Literature and Literary Theory, 5 papers in Cultural Studies and 4 papers in Marketing. Recurrent topics in Karen Halttunen’s work include Gothic Literature and Media Analysis (4 papers), American History and Culture (4 papers) and Crime and Detective Fiction Studies (4 papers). Karen Halttunen is often cited by papers focused on Gothic Literature and Media Analysis (4 papers), American History and Culture (4 papers) and Crime and Detective Fiction Studies (4 papers). Karen Halttunen collaborates with scholars based in United States. Karen Halttunen's co-authors include Lewis Perry, Nancy Isenberg, Czesław Miłosz, Jeffrey Johnson and Carolyn Strange and has published in prestigious journals such as The American Historical Review, Journal of American History and The William and Mary Quarterly.
